Публикации по теме 'angularjs'
Как переход на Angular 5 влияет на производительность
Тенденция Angular резко возросла по сравнению с предыдущим годом. Angular — выдающийся веб-интерфейс с открытым исходным кодом, а также платформа для мобильных приложений, разработанная Google. Он развивается как AngularJS в JavaScript и основан на Angular Model View Controller в качестве архитектурного прототипа.
Некоторое время назад было два крупных и популярных релиза, названных Angular 4 и Angular 5. Последние версии Angular с 2 по 5 основаны на Typescript и Model View Model..
Отзывчивые равные высоты с угловой директивой
Давайте посмотрим на очень распространенный вариант использования. У вас есть список предметов, вам нужно все красиво отобразить на экране в виде карточек.
Выглядит нормально, но вы хотите, чтобы все карточки всегда были одинаковой высоты . Он всегда должен соответствовать высоте самого высокого объекта и соответственно изменять размер при изменении размера экрана.
Мы можем добиться этого с помощью создания настраиваемой директивы.
Интересный? Прочтите мою статью на виски...
Не пишите модульные тесты ES6 Angular 1.x таким образом!
Не пишите модульные тесты ES6 Angular 1.x таким образом !
Работая консультантом, я все чаще сталкивался с этим паттерном в исходниках, которые мне приходилось либо поддерживать, либо работать с ними. Вот почему я твердо верю, что этот подход к кодированию/тестированию является антишаблоном модульного тестирования Angular .
Это делает невозможным повторное использование отдельных компонентов
Допустим, у нас есть следующий код:
Как потребитель вашей библиотеки, как я могу..
Как создать интерфейсное приложение с использованием стека MEAN
Давайте станем стройными и злыми с помощью MEAN STACK!
В этом руководстве я шаг за шагом расскажу вам, как создать потрясающее приложение для обмена списками покупок, которое включает аутентификацию, сохранение пользовательского контента в вашей MongoDB с помощью Mongoose, все клиентские (интерфейсные) и серверные. -внутренняя (внутренняя) маршрутизация и некоторые интересные CSS-трюки с использованием UI-Bootstrap (Bootstrap для приложений Angular).
Что такое ЗНАЧЕНИЕ?
TL; DR -..
58 день — код 365
Пн, 8 февраля 2016 г.
Итак, сегодня я закончила свои часы Pomodoro! Это был последний из 4 основных проектов разработки внешнего интерфейса для Free Code Camp .
Вещи, о которых я узнал:
Некоторые тонкости setInterval и clearInterval Некоторые основы SVG Больше практики использования KnockoutJS Некоторые основы создания таймеров
Некоторые мысли:
Нокаут действительно полезен, но, возможно, немного устарел. Я изучил некоторые основы во время прохождения курса Front End..
Преобразование речи в текст IBM Cloud: две реализации
Три года назад я внедрил IBM Cloud Speech-to-Text в свое веб-приложение LanguageTwo. Это была худшая часть моего приложения. Потоковое соединение WebSockets было в лучшем случае ненадежным. Я потратил три недели на то, чтобы починить это.
В моем проекте используются AngularJS и Firebase.
Мой первый план состоял в том, чтобы прекратить потоковую передачу WebSockets и вместо этого записывать каждый аудиофайл, сохранять его в базе данных, отправлять файл в IBM Cloud для обработки, а..
Использовать ES6 с Angular 1.x просто
На прошлой неделе я посетил хакатон и, чтобы познакомиться с ES6 в сочетании с Angular 1.x, решил использовать именно его. И это было намного проще, чем я ожидал!
Допустим, у нас есть следующая структура приложения
/ приложение
/ example (главный файл компонента) example-controller (компонентный контроллер) example-directive (компонентная директива) example-service (компонентный сервис)
Мы хотим использовать классы ES6 везде, где это возможно, и я объясню, как это..